About SCHOOL 17-ENRICO FERMI

Located at 158 ORCHARD ST, in ROCHESTER, New York, SCHOOL 17-ENRICO FERMI is a mid-sized elementary campus that enrolls 525 students (grades pre-K through 6), part of ROCHESTER CITY SCHOOL DISTRICT.

Across the 51 schools in ROCHESTER CITY SCHOOL DISTRICT (25,949 students total), SCHOOL 17-ENRICO FERMI accounts for its share of the district's footprint.

Looking at the student body, SCHOOL 17-ENRICO FERMI logs that the largest single group is Hispanic, at 64% of enrollment; the rest reads as 26% Black, 4% White, 4% multiracial. That is noticeably more Hispanic than the county at large, where the share is closer to 10%.

Looking at school resources, The school reports having 42 full-time-equivalent teachers, for a student-teacher ratio near 12.5:1. The state averages about 12.8:1, putting this campus right in line with peers. About 76% of enrolled students meet the income threshold for free or reduced-price lunch, a number frequently used as a low-income enrollment indicator. Set against Monroe County (around 50%), the school's rate is north of typical.

Adjusting for the school's free-and-reduced-lunch share, SCHOOL 17-ENRICO FERMI falls in the UNDERPERFORMING tier of the BeatsExpectations residual. Given its student profile, a typical campus would land near 47.2%; this one comes in at 4.3%, -42.8 points off the demographic line.

In the broader community, census data for Monroe County shows median household earnings sit near $76,382, about 42% of the adult population holds a bachelor's degree or above, and census figures put the poverty rate at about 9%. In all, Monroe County runs 186 public schools (combined enrollment of about 106,108 students), of which SCHOOL 17-ENRICO FERMI is one.

Nearest neighbor: SCHOOL 5-JOHN WILLIAMS, around 0.5 miles off. Counting just inside five miles, 8 other public schools cluster around SCHOOL 17-ENRICO FERMI. Among the 7 schools in that immediate cluster with test data (this one included), SCHOOL 17-ENRICO FERMI ranks 7th on composite proficiency, beneath the local average of 14.7%.

The school occupies a metropolitan site.

Over the past 7-year window. SCHOOL 17-ENRICO FERMI's enrollment has shrank 16% since 2018, when it stood at 626 (now 525). The Black share of enrollment edged down from 39% to 26% over that span. The student-to-teacher ratio widened from 11.2:1 in 2018 to 12.5:1 today.
